About the role

  • Serve as the Architectural Authority for the Salesforce platform, guiding internal teams and engaging with vendors, SIs, and external Salesforce communities.
  • Champion Salesforce best practices and platform governance, developing and maintaining architecture principles, standards, reusable design patterns, and development guidelines.
  • Lead solution design workshops and technical discovery sessions with stakeholders, product owners, and business analysts to define scalable, secure, and maintainable solutions.
  • Build and maintain the Salesforce architecture roadmap, aligning with enterprise strategy and upcoming Salesforce capabilities (e.g., AI, MuleSoft, Tableau).
  • Provide technical leadership and governance across Salesforce projects, ensuring alignment with the Salesforce Center of Excellence (CoE) and enterprise architecture strategy.
  • Drive innovation by evaluating new Salesforce technologies and AppExchange solutions to solve emerging business needs.
  • Proactively reduce technical debt, driving continuous platform improvement and optimization.
  • Collaborate with security and compliance teams to ensure adherence to GDPR, ISO, and internal data protection policies.
  • Govern cross-functional and enterprise integrations, acting as Salesforce Design Authority and ensuring seamless interaction with other platforms.
  • Mentor and coach Salesforce architects, developers, and administrators, fostering a strong technical community and enforcing adherence to standards.
  • Maintain up-to-date technical documentation, including solution architecture diagrams, integration specs, and governance policies.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ience architecting and delivering Salesforce solutions at scale across Sales (including CPQ), Service, Marketing, or Experience Clouds.
  • Deep hands-on expertise with Salesforce technologies: Apex (incl. FFLib), Lightning Web Components (LWC), Flow Builder, SOQL/SOSL, Platform Events, and API integrations (REST/SOAP).
  • Strong understanding of Salesforce security architecture, performance optimization, and data modeling.
  • Proven track record of leading enterprise-level projects and delivering impactful business outcomes.
  • Skilled in Force.com, Heroku, and the broader Salesforce ecosystem including Partner/AppExchange solutions.
  • Experience in both Agile and Waterfall development methodologies.
  • Proficient in enterprise architecture disciplines: integration design, relational database modeling, web services, and data migration.
  • Strong communicator with the ability to translate complex technical concepts into business value for a wide range of stakeholders.
  • Demonstrated ability to influence strategic decisions, align cross-functional teams, and drive platform adoption.
  • Salesforce certifications strongly preferred: Application Architect, System Architect, B2C Solution Architect, Integration Architect.
